Alrosa B738 at St. Petersburg on May 20th 2018, rejected takeoff due to engine failure
Last Update: May 21, 2018 / 22:24:16 GMT/Zulu time
Incident Facts
Date of incident
May 20, 2018
Classification
Incident
Airline
Alrosa Mirny Air Enterprise
Flight number
6R-506
Departure
Saint Petersburg, Russia
Destination
Mirny, Russia
Aircraft Registration
EI-FCH
Aircraft Type
Boeing 737-800
ICAO Type Designator
B738
The occurrence aircraft is still on the ground 35 hours after the rejected takeoff.
Russia's North-West Investigation Department opened an investigation into the occurrence.
